As an Offshore Chemist you will be required to perform sampling and analysis to recognised Client standard methods and documented procedures. You will be required to deliver consistently high standards of analytical performance and ensure smooth and continued operation of the laboratory.

Key Accountabilities

 

  • Demonstrate compliance to all test methods, procedures and quality systems essential criteria essential for best practices.
  • Liaise with line manager/ on shore support/ if a problem with equipment, methods or samples occurs and initiate corrective actions to ensure continuity of service. 
  • Identify and implement improvements to current laboratory operations in order to maximise equipment availability, ensure technical standards are maintained and improved thus ensuring profitability.
  • Ensure adequate stock of consumables to ensure continuous productivity.
  • Ensure testing equipment is calibrated and safe/ suitable for use.
  • Completion of daily, weekly and monthly routine sampling, analysis and reporting as per client procedures.
  • Liaison with SGS lab onshore support.
  • Maintain organised and auditable systems of work to permit traceability and ensure compliance.
  • Delivery of agreed analysis to timescales and cost to enable fulfilment of contractual KPI’s and maximise profitability.
  • Comprehensive understanding and knowledge of laboratory and analytical techniques and equipment to promote continuous improvement and provision of quality service to client.
  • Resolution of enquiries in a timely and effective manner to ensure consistency of service delivery and agreed contractual obligations.
  • Provision of reports to line manager/ onshore support/ to assist in service, standards and delivery.
